What negative impact did chemistry have on society through the production and use of chlorofluorocarbons (CFCs)?

Chemistry
1 answer:
vodka [1.7K]3 years ago
5 0
Chlorofluorocarbons (CFCs) are used generally in aerosols, sprays, perfume, refrigerants, insulation foams and other stuffs. Throughout its applications, the negative impacts weighed more than its benefits. Its greater setback is the contribution to the thinning of the ozone layer which exposes us more with the harmful ultraviolet rays from the sun.

Calculate the mass of CaCl2•2H2O required to make 100.0 mL of a 0.100 M solution. Each of the calculations below will take you t
Zolol [24]

Answer:

The mass is 1.4701 grams and the moles is 0.01.

Explanation:

Based on the given question, the volume of the solution is 100 ml or 0.1 L and the molarity of the solution is 0.100 M. The moles of the solute (in the given case calcium chloride dihydride (CaCl2. H2O) can be determined by using the formula,  

Molarity = moles of solute/volume of solution in liters

Now putting the values we get,  

0.100 = moles of solute/0.1000

Moles of solute = 0.100 * 0.1000

= 0.01 moles

The mass of CaCl2.2H2O can be determined by using the formula,  

Moles = mass/molar mass

The molar mass of CaCl2.2H2O is 147.01 gram per mole. Now putting the values we get,  

0.01 = mass / 147.01

Mass = 147.01 * 0.01

= 1.4701 grams.
